我的视频无法加载并托管在 github 上。github不允许视频吗?
我已经尝试了很多 src="Links"
<video width="320" height="240" controls>
<source src="../../Websiteland/Twitter/FLT.mp4" type="video/mpeg">
Your browser does not support this awesome video title.
</video>
我的视频无法加载并托管在 github 上。github不允许视频吗?
我已经尝试了很多 src="Links"
<video width="320" height="240" controls>
<source src="../../Websiteland/Twitter/FLT.mp4" type="video/mpeg">
Your browser does not support this awesome video title.
</video>
video/mpeg
是表单中的有效 MIME 类型,但它是 MPEG-1 视频之一。所以浏览器会尝试使用他们的video/mpeg
解码器,找不到任何解码器,或者只是无法在您的 mp4 视频上使用它并最终中止。
你想要video/mp4
:
<video width="320" height="240" controls>
<source type="video/mp4" src="https://robocop79.github.io/Websiteland//Twitter/FLT.mp4">
</video>
看起来 iframe 被 github 禁用了,你不能再使用这个技巧了。它说,为了帮助保护进入本网站的安全信息,该内容的发布者不允许将其显示在框架中。
如此处所示:
“找不到支持格式和 MIME 类型的视频”错误消息与 HTML5 媒体播放器有关。
因此,您在 Windows 中似乎不支持以可用格式播放媒体文件。另请参阅:“ Firefox 中的 HTML5 音频和视频”
我在 Chrome 中看不到错误消息,但视频也无法播放。
作为替代方案,您可以考虑:
nathancy/jekyll-embed-video
嵌入视频播放器。那是:
<div class="embed-container">
<iframe
src="https://www.youtube.com/embed/{{ include.id }}"
width="700"
height="480"
frameborder="0"
allowfullscreen="">
</iframe>
</div>
我已经更新了我的 GitHub 页面并重新加载了我的网站(仅使用我的网站 url),但它没有工作......
然后,我/index.html
在我的网站网址后申请。它开始工作(仅使用website_url/index.html
)。